掌握Matlab生成m序列的源码实战技巧

版权申诉
0 下载量 14 浏览量 更新于2024-10-31 收藏 6.35MB RAR 举报
资源摘要信息:"本资源提供了一套使用Matlab软件实现生成m序列(最大长度序列)的源代码,可用于数学建模和相关教学、研究项目。m序列,也称为伪随机噪声序列,广泛应用于通信领域,如扩频通信、加密通信等。Matlab作为一款高性能的数学软件,提供了强大的数学计算和仿真功能,使得开发和测试这类算法变得更加便捷。 数学建模是一种通过数学工具和方法对现实世界中的问题进行抽象和简化,建立起数学模型,以解决实际问题的过程。它涉及从观察现象到提出假设,再到建立模型,最后求解和验证模型的完整流程。在建模过程中,数学模型需要能够反映出被研究系统的本质特征,并能根据输入数据产生合理输出,以便对实际问题进行预测和控制。 本资源中的Matlab源代码部分,展示了如何利用Matlab语言编写程序来生成m序列。m序列具有良好的自相关性质和互相关性质,它们对于系统性能的优化和抗干扰能力的提升有着重要作用。在源代码中,通过编写特定的算法,可以生成具有特定长度和特性的m序列,这些序列在信号处理、通信系统仿真等领域有着广泛的应用。 学习和使用本资源中的Matlab源码,可以帮助用户深入了解m序列的生成原理和应用,并通过实践提高自己在数学建模及Matlab编程方面的能力。同时,本资源的下载和使用对于那些希望通过实例学习Matlab实战项目的人员,提供了一个很好的学习材料。通过对源码的分析和修改,用户可以更好地掌握Matlab编程技巧,并能够应用到自己的项目中去。 在文件名称列表中,只有一个文件名“test”,这表明可能只提供了一个简单的测试脚本或实例文件,用于演示m序列生成的代码。用户在使用时,可能需要结合Matlab环境和相关的数学知识,对代码进行深入理解和应用。"